'Fruitless and wasteful': General uses SANDF truck for private garden work

Opposition parties are demanding answers after an SANDF truck was reportedly sent more than 1 200km to remove tree stumps from a senior officer’s property in Pretoria. The military crane truck, based in Oudtshoorn, was ordered to abandon its original assignment and travel across the country to Major-General Edward Mulaudzi’s residence in Waterkloof Ridge. The truck’s task? To remove two tree stumps from his garden after complaints by neighbours.…
